How much do airport staff get paid USA?

How much does an Airport Worker make? As of Sep 22, 2023, the average hourly pay for an Airport Worker in the United States is $17.16 an hour.

The estimated total pay for a Airport Ground Staff is $57,441 per year in the United States area, with an average salary of $52,584 per year. These numbers represent the median, which is the midpoint of the ranges from our proprietary Total Pay Estimate model and based on salaries collected from our users.

Today, median wages for many airport service workers, including cleaners, wheelchair agents, ticketing and check-in agents, and baggage handlers, fall below the private sector median of $20.40 per hour.

What is the hardest job at the airport? Working as a gate agent is one of the most challenging jobs at the airport—and perhaps the most under-appreciated role. Tasked with checking bags, amending reservations, and closing out flights, gate agents might have the most diverse work of any airline employee.
